Excerpt from The Pupil's Workbook in the Geography of California: The Problem Method The New Geography. During recent years a great revolution has taken place in the teaching of geography. \'ve no longer stress merely the locational, the political, the physical, or the economic and commercial phases of the subject for their own sake. Instead we aim to teach all the facts of geography in connection with the ways in which they affect human life. Problem Study. \vith the change in the viewpoint has come a great change in method. Instead of striving to teach children to memorize a great mass of facts, we endeavor to interest them and to promote the study by presenting worth-while problems to be solved. This has led to the socialized recitation, in which teachers and students work out the problems together, and to the introduction of the project method of teaching. It is almost impossible to make a project textbook, but the problems given in this book will suggest many projects which can be worked out by students in the classroom and at home. The Importance of California Geography. No other state is as varied as California in its geography, and in no other state can so many interesting geographical problems be found. In this book we have tried to interest children, to give them an understanding of California's wonderful resources and their uses, and to provide a basis for comparing California with other areas. Excerpt from The Geography of California The geography of California is a vast and many sided subject which has never yet been adequately treated. It is not the intention of the author in presenting this little hand-book to take up the subject in an exhaustive manner, for that would require a large volume. Nor is his intention to present a mere description of the various aspects of the geography of the State, for this has already been done, although in an inadequate manner, in various little school supplements and advertising pamphlets. Moreover, mere description cannot impart real geographic knowledge, since we must know something of causes and relations. The object which the author has in mind is rather to give a simple and yet detailed description of the conditions under which we are living, and weave them into a connected and rational whole, so that teachers and pupils may acquire the elements of a rational knowledge of California. As our work in geography is at present outlined it is ridiculously unphilosophical as well as thoroughly inadequate. The geography of California is extraordinarily varied and interesting. Children should not leave school without some elementary conceptions of the origin and meaning of the physical features about them, of the strongly contrasted climatic conditions, and of the influence which these exert upon our lives. To meet the above need the author has woven together in as simple manner as possible those facts and relations which should be known and appreciated by every educated resident of California. Exploring California through Project-Based Leaning includes 50 well-thought-out projects designed for grades 3-5. In assigning your students projects that dig into CaliforniaÕs geography, history, government, economy, current events, and famous people, you will deepen their appreciation and understanding of California while simultaneously improving their analytical skills and ability to recognize patterns and big-picture themes. Project-based learning today is much different than the craft-heavy classroom activities popular in the past. Inquiry, planning, research, collaboration, and analysis are key components of project-based learning activities today. However, that doesnÕt mean creativity, individual expression, and fun are out. They definitely arenÕt! Each project is designed to help students gain important knowledge and skills that are derived from standards and key concepts at the heart of academic subject areas. Students are asked to analyze and solve problems, to gather and interpret data, to develop and evaluate solutions, to support their answers with evidence, to think critically in a sustained way, and to use their newfound knowledge to formulate new questions worthy of exploring. While some projects are more complex and take longer than others, they all are set up in the same structure. Each begins with the central project-driving questions, proceeds through research and supportive questions, has the student choose a presentation option, and ends with a broader-view inquiry. Rubrics for reflection and assessments are included, too. This consistent framework will make it easier for you assign projects and for your students to follow along and consistently meet expectations. Encourage your students to take charge of their projects as much as possible. As a teacher, you can act as a facilitator and guide. The projects are structured such that students can often work through the process on their own or through cooperation with their classmates.
